This may be common knowledge, but I thought it was interesting. I was watching a documentary on VW's history. They were talking about the 1953 split window and how it had the oval window style dash. It was refered to as a "Zwiter". The word "zwiter" means hermaphradite in german. Now I know you sick minded individuals out there might say that sound nasty, but it makes sense, huh... There was like 57k of these models made. Well needless to say I have a new favorite in the beetle world. Chad, I am certainly no expert by any means, but I do think Zwitters have 'zwitter only' parts. The dome light is one, they have chrome molding for the rear split windows and I think there may be one or two other things but I am not sure.
